6 pages, via Online journal, Most agricultural soils are depleted of their soil organic matter (SOM) reserves. A severe loss of SOM content may degrade soil functionality, its capacity for provisioning of essential ecosystem services, and soil health. Therefore, restoration of SOM content in soils of agroecosystems may reverse the degradation trends, enhance ecosystem services (Banwart et al. 2015), and advance Sustainable Development Goals of the United Nations. (Lal et al. 2018a). Increase in SOM content may also partially replace the use of chemical fertilizers and supplemental irrigation, while restoring the environment.
